On February 24, 2024, hometown musician Brandon Wolfe Scott, opened for Sam Roberts Band, at the Commodore Ballroom.
The room was already abuzz before the rockers from Montreal took the stage. And it didn’t settle down once the Sam Roberts Band took the stage. It was “Them Kids” that amped the crowd up. But the party officially began a few songs later when the band kicked into “Where Have All The Good People Gone?”.
